
Yahia Hegazy
15 years of IT experience, 10 years of software development
Cleveland, United StatesWork Experience
It Support SpecialistFull Time
USDA
Jun 2020 - Present -5 yrs, 3 months
United States , Cleveland
- Job Details:I’m the designer and developer for virtual grower web. This is a web-based application built using the react.js framework. I have knowledge in Konva, an HTML canvas library as well as tailwind CSS, indexeddb, plotly (a D3 wrapper). I have familiarity with redux, typescript, and react native. I also maintain, implement, configure, and or repair all computers and related peripheral systems and equipment of mixed OS environments.
Linux System EngineerFull Time
- Job Details:- Led critical infrastructure enhancement contract, overseeing meticulous upgrade of 800+ RHEL and openSUSE servers. Conducted holistic health and resource evaluations, ensuring seamless migrations. - Employed g-parted, f-disk, yast to adeptly expand disk space, optimizing resources and system performance. - Devised data processing scripts for underperforming servers, boosting efficiency, and reducing overhead. - Enhanced documentation, optimizing process control; aided new engineers with swift acclimatization. - Exemplified unwavering commitment to precision, driving enhanced server performance and operational excellence.
Software EngineerFull Time
TMW Systems
Jun 2013 - Feb 2018 -4 yrs, 8 months
United States , Cleveland
- Job Details:Software Quality Assurance & Documentation Created several in-house functionality in Perl & JavaScript Strong analytical skills with deductive reasoning in white, gray and black box testing Track, document and regress bugs for TMW Imaging using JIRA Execute manual tests and circle of services against TMW Imaging to ensure that the existing product and new features are stable and functioning as intended. Developed automated tests using F# Selenium (Canopy) Writing documentation using Docbook standards for new product features Use SOAPUI to test web service communications between TMW Imaging and other in house applications Linux System Administration (RHEL/CentOS/Scientific Linux 6) Physical to Virtual, Virtual to Virtual and Virtual to Physical migrations of Linux servers from and to VMware, VirtualBox, Hyper-V and other legacy hardware Includes installation, testing, upgrading, loading patches, troubleshooting both physical and virtual environments Use YUM software manager to install and configure RPM packages Continuously create and improve on bash/shell scripts for various tasks to automate repeated processes. Configure logical volumes using LVM. Created documentation on shrinking logical volumes using LVM Train new and existing users on how to use basic Linux command lines. Integration testing between TMW Imaging (Linux) and various Windows based dispatch systems Ensure Linux based printer drivers communicate with printers Familiar with DNS, LDAP, Network Manager, and DHCP. LDAP integration of Windows Active Directory accounts for TMW Imaging Installed, configured, and troubleshot Amanda (backup), Sendmail, and other various Linux based applications Some familiarity with Zabbix, AWS, Git, Nginx, Ansible
Systems AnalystFull Time
Cleveland Clinic Foundation
Jun 2007 - Jan 2013 -5 yrs, 7 months
United States , Cleveland
- Job Details:Held semi-monthly meetings with clinical managers in Radiology to discuss about new/existing equipments or issues in their departments. ● I lead a successful move from a multi-location department under a centralized location within the proposed budget and finished 1 week before Go Live. ● Acted as a supervisor & lead for a team of 10 to 15 System Analyst I & II. Coached, trained, and educated new and current analysts on applications used in Radiology Informatics. ● Coordinated, planned and executed various projects for clinical managers such as new scanners, additional data drops for existing equipments, RIS work-lists, RIS reports, and integration between Syngo Workflow (v28) and EPIC. Identified, investigated and resolved projects, tasks or assignments through ITSM of system or application errors ensuring the solution was done in a timely manner and of top quality. ● Coordinated and performed in-depth tests for existing and new systems and other post-implementation support. ● Always willing to spend extra time to complete assigned work ● Maintained and documented completed tasks on a weekly basis and presented the report to management ● Conducted 30 minute team meetings once a week to discuss new ideas, processes, and strategies
Education
Bachelor of Science in Computer Science & Engineering Technology
University of ToledoJan 2002 - Jan 2006 - 4 yr
Skills
View More
Languages
Arabic
FluentEnglish
Fluent